Does anyone know how to remove the Infiniti (Mt. Fuji) emblem on our trunk.
The gold is fading and I'm going to wrap it in gold chrome.. it's hard to do it with it on.

You can use a heat gun or if you dont have one fishing string does the trick along with a little WD-40 to get rid of the glue residue.
